Russian Foreign Ministry spokeswoman Maria Zakharova accused Western countries of inciting Russian citizens to carry out "acts of vandalism" at polling stations and diplomats from these countries in Moscow of doing "everything to interfere in the vote." (HANDLE)


The spokeswoman for the Russian Foreign Ministry, Maria Zakharova, accused Western countries of inciting Russian citizens to carry out "acts of vandalism" at polling stations and diplomats from these countries in Moscow of doing "everything to interfere in the vote".

The West "has simply turned to extremist activities", said the spokeswoman, quoted by the Ria Novosti agency, speaking at a conference.
